Solution for -7p-3(6-5p)=6(p-6)-6 equation:


Simplifying
-7p + -3(6 + -5p) = 6(p + -6) + -6
-7p + (6 * -3 + -5p * -3) = 6(p + -6) + -6
-7p + (-18 + 15p) = 6(p + -6) + -6

Reorder the terms:
-18 + -7p + 15p = 6(p + -6) + -6

Combine like terms: -7p + 15p = 8p
-18 + 8p = 6(p + -6) + -6

Reorder the terms:
-18 + 8p = 6(-6 + p) + -6
-18 + 8p = (-6 * 6 + p * 6) + -6
-18 + 8p = (-36 + 6p) + -6

Reorder the terms:
-18 + 8p = -36 + -6 + 6p

Combine like terms: -36 + -6 = -42
-18 + 8p = -42 + 6p

Solving
-18 + 8p = -42 + 6p

Solving for variable 'p'.

Move all terms containing p to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-6p' to each side of the equation.
-18 + 8p + -6p = -42 + 6p + -6p

Combine like terms: 8p + -6p = 2p
-18 + 2p = -42 + 6p + -6p

Combine like terms: 6p + -6p = 0
-18 + 2p = -42 + 0
-18 + 2p = -42

Add '18' to each side of the equation.
-18 + 18 + 2p = -42 + 18

Combine like terms: -18 + 18 = 0
0 + 2p = -42 + 18
2p = -42 + 18

Combine like terms: -42 + 18 = -24
2p = -24

Divide each side by '2'.
p = -12

Simplifying
p = -12
